The Hampton University outdoor track and field teams kicked off their seasons at the University of South Florida Alumni Invitational, recording several commendable performances. Notable finishes included Brianna Charles placing fifth in the women's 200 meters and Carmen PenaSoto finishing 15th in the women鈥檚 100 meter hurdles. The women鈥檚 relay teams achieved eighth and 13th positions in the 4x100 and ninth and 11th in the 4x400. On the men鈥檚 side, Ethan Moody secured 18th in the 400 meters while the 4x100 relay team took sixth.

By the Numbers
  • Brianna Charles finished 5th in the women's 200 meters with a time of 23.61.
  • The women's 4x100 relay team placed 8th with a time of 45.28.
  • Ethan Moody finished 18th in the men's 400 meters with a time of 47.53.
  • The men's 4x100 relay team finished 6th with a time of 40.19.
